GENOMICS OF AD AND OTHER NEURODEGENERATIVE DISEASES
John HardyUK Dementia Research Institute at UCL Queen Square Institute of Neurology, Department of Neurodegenerative Diseases & Reta Lila Weston
Laboratories, London, United Kingdom
Genetic analyses of the common neurodegenerative diseases are revealing many loci for each of them, and point to approaches in management. For example, the association of APP with Alzheimer’s disease and the subsequent development Amyloid hypotheses are the foundation for the many Alzheimer’s disease trials. The recent failures of targeting amyloid in Alzheimer’s disease treatment prompt second thoughts on the approach, including but not limited to case selection and timing of treatment.
Based on the findings of multiple genetic loci in recent past, researchers using other omics and bioinformatics are now starting to put together the jigsaw. This explosion of information begins to reveal commonalities on the loci involved in each disease entity. These are for Alzheimer’s disease, amyloid induced neuronal damage, for typical Parkinson’s disease, lysosomes and autophagic clearance, for early onset Parkinson’s disease, mitophagy, for fronto-temporal dementia / am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, the ubiquitin proteasome, and for the pure am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, the stress granule response.
This idea of a failing damage response will hopefully begin to enable links to be drawn between the genetic, transcriptomics, biomarkers and pathogenesis of the diseases. Coupled with other clinical information and epidemiological assessments of risk factors for the diseases, these will provide new angles in the management of neurodegenerative diseases.

THE MAKING AND KEEPING OF MEMORY
Richard GM MorrisThe University of Edinburgh, Edinburgh, UK
Understanding the neurobiology of memory is recognised as one of the grand challenges of contemporary neuroscience. It is a problem to be approached from multiple levels of analysis - from ‘top-down’ in recognising the several qualitatively different types of memory and their brain imaging correlates, through to ‘bottom-up’ approaches reflecting likely conserved and newly evolved molecular mechanisms of neuronal plasticity. I shall begin with a focus on the neurophysiology of the ‘making’ of memory (encoding) and describe recent research using rodents (rats) which supports the involvement of activity-dependent synaptic plasticity in memory trace formation, but calls into question whether postsynaptic cell firing is always required (Rossato et al, Current Biology, 2018). I shall then turn to the ‘keeping’ of memory (consolidation) with a focus on one specific aspect of memory retention. This derives from the ‘synaptic tagging and capture’ model of protein synthesis-dependent long-term potentiation (Frey and Morris, Nature 1997) which asserts that, as much memory encoding is automatic, there must be selectivity to its retention to avoid saturation of the distributed networks of the hippocampus and related structures that mediate recent memory storage. This leads on to an exploration of the determinants of selectivity, including the impact of peri-event novelty in enhancing retention through its enhancement of protein synthesis. This issue has recently been explored in mice using optogenetic techniques focusing, somewhat surprisingly, on the locus coeruleus (Takeuchi et al, Nature, 2016).

BLOOD-BRAIN BARRIER AND CNS DYSFUNCTION AND PROTECTION
Berislav V. ZlokovicZilkha Neurogenetic Institute, Department of Physiology and Neuroscience, Keck School of Medicine, University of Southern California, Los
Angeles, United States
I will discuss the cellular and molecular mechanisms underlying the link between BBB dysfunction and CNS dysfunction, and protection. Examples will include the roles of brain endothelial MSFD2a, LRP1, and GLUT1 gene in maintaining the BBB integrity and normal neuronal structure function, and genetic defects in vascular cells contributing to rare monogenic human neurological disorders. Next, will discuss human Alzheimer’s PICALM mutations, and their effects on Abeta BBB clearance. Then, will examine our recent neuroimaging and CSF findings indicating that BBB breakdown is an independent early biomarker of human cognitive dysfunction. Then, will briefly review our findings in pericyte-deficient models including pericyte-specific ablation model causing rapid loss of neurons caused by circulatory failure and loss of pericyte-derived neurotrophic factor, pleiotrophin. Then will turn to neurodegeneration therapeutic approaches targeting vascular cells including endothelial-specific AAV2-BR1-mediated delivery of LRP1 minigene and inhibition of the proinflammatory cyclophilin A (CypA)-MMP9 pathway, and early attempts with iPSC-derived human pericytes to improve BBB integrity and Ab and tau clearance. Finally, I will discuss treatment of stroke with 3K3A-activated protein C (APC), a BBB stabilizing, anti-inflammatory protease that has successfully completed Phase 2a trial in stroke patients. I will show our recent findings on 3K3A-APC-mediated post-ischemic brain regeneration and formation of functional mouse-human hybrid neuronal circuits with human-derived neural stem cells, and 3K3A-APC treatments for white matter stroke, ALS (mouse model and human iPSC-derived C9 motor neuron ALS model), and effects in a mouse model of AD. Potential and applications for human trials will be discussed.

GENE DELIVERY ACROSS THE BLOOD-BRAIN-BARRIER, WHOLE-BODY TISSUE CLEARING, AND OPTOGENETICS TO UNDERSTAND AND INFLUENCE PHYSIOLOGY AND BEHAVIOR
Viviana GradinaruMolecular and Cellular Neuroscience Center of the Chen Institute, California Institute of Technology CALTECH, Pasadena, CA, United States
Our research group at Caltech develops and employs optogenetics, tissue clearing, and viral vectors to gain new insights on circuits underlying locomotion, reward, and sleep. In most recent work the group has delineated novel arousal-promoting dopaminergic circuits that might be at the root of sleep disturbances common to numerous neuropsychiatric disorders (Cho et al., Neuron, 2017). Present-day neuroscience relies on genetically-encoded tools; in both transgenic and non-transgenic animals, current practice for vector delivery is stereotaxic brain surgery—an invasive method that can cause hemorrhages and non-uniform expression over a limited volume. To address this limitation, we have developed viral-vector selection methods to identify engineered capsids capable of reaching target cell-populations across the body and brain after noninvasive systemic delivery (Deverman et al, Nature Biotechnology, 2016). We use whole-body tissue clearing to facilitate transduction maps of systemically delivered genes (Yang et al, Cell, 2014; Treweek et al, Nature Protocols, 2016). With novel AAV capsids, we achieved brain-wide transduction in adult mice after systemic delivery and sparse stochastic Golgi-like genetic labeling that enables morphology tracing for both central and peripheral neurons (Chan et al, Nature Neuroscience, 2017). Viral vectors that can efficiently and selectively deliver transgenes to target tissues after injection into the bloodstream allow us to genetically modify a high percentage of desired cells with more homogeneous coverage, without the need for either highly invasive direct injections or time-consuming transgenesis. Since CNS disorders are notoriously challenging due to the restrictive nature of the blood brain barrier, the recombinant vectors engineered to overcome this barrier can enable potential future use of exciting advances in gene editing via the CRISPR-Cas, RNA interference and gene replacement strategies to restore diseased CNS circuits.

BRAIN & MIND: WHO IS THE PUPPET AND WHO THE PUPPETEER?
George PaxinosUniversity of New South Wales, Australia
After presenting some of what he learned through his journey in the brain, the speaker will address the question in the title, a question with social, legal and religious implications. If the mind controls the brain, then there is FREE WILL and its corollaries, dignity and responsibility. You are king in your skull-sized kingdom. You are the architect of your destiny. If, on the other hand, the brain controls the mind, an incendiary conclusion follows: There can be no FREE WILL, no praise, no punishment and no purgatory. Our brain is the riverbed that holds and channels our stream of consciousness (Koch, 2012). It is molded by the family and the culture we are raised in. Experience sculpts out our character from the genetic material we are granted as Phidias sculpted Apollo from a block of Parian marble. Alzheimer’s disease will pay an unwelcome visit to many of us at the end of life. It will disrupt the internal structure of our neurons and we will be living evidence the mind is the product of the brain and has no influence on it. Which one of us would not like to discard our depression, anxieties, obsessions, compulsions, our unrequited love? If only the puppet could get hold of one of the strings with which the brain makes it dance. It seems the puppet is free only in as much as it loves its strings (Harris, 2012).

GAMMA FREQUENCY ENTRAINMENT USING SENSORY STIMULI CONFERS NEUROPROTECTION AND ENHANCES COGNITIVE FUNCTION
Li-Huei TsaiPicower Institute for Learning and Memory, Department of Brain and Cognitive Sciences, Massachusetts Institute of Technology, Cambridge, MA,
United States
Rhythmic neural activity in the gamma range (30-80 Hz) is modulated during various aspects of cognitive function and has been shown to be disrupted in several neurological conditions, including Alzheimer’s disease (AD). Impaired gamma oscillations have also been reported in several AD mouse models, even before the onset of Aβ accumulation and major cognitive impairment. It is well established that local network oscillations at specific frequencies can be induced in cortical areas using sensory stimuli. Recently, we applied this approach, which we term Gamma ENtrainment Using Sensory stimuli (GENUS), using a light programmed to flicker at 40 Hz to induce gamma oscillations in the visual cortex of AD model mice. We found a profound reduction in amyloid load in visual cortex after 1 hr of visual GENUS that appears to involve the concerted actions of many different cell types, including neurons and microglia to reduce the production and enhance clearance of Aβ, respectively. Chronic exposure to GENUS reduced amyloid plaque and phosphorylated Tau pathology in multiple brain regions in 5XFAD and P301S transgenic mice, respectively, and improved learning and memory. Therefore, GENUS represents a novel and powerful non-invasive approach to combat AD related pathology and symptoms. We are currently testing GENUS in human subjects to determine it’s utility in tackling human neurological disorder.
